Columbia’s Nevado del Ruiz volcano is “days or weeks” from erupting according to the Volcanic Observatory in Manizales, Columbia.

Smoke and ash is rising out of the volcano just days after an “orange alert” was issued leading to at least 150 families being evacuated from along rivers that flow down the mountain.

People living on the mountain’s slopes reported “strange noises” coming from the mountain’s summit over the weekend. The ash and smoke has reached the level that 30,000 face masks have been given out to residents in towns surrounding the volcano.

The airport in Manizales has been shut down due to ash and is expected to remain closed until the volcano goes dormant.

In 1985, an eruption from Navado del Ruiz caused a mudslide that killed over 25,000 people. The town of Armero along the banks of the Lagunilla river was almost completely wiped off the face of the earth. Glaciers and snow melted by the lava rushed down the hill at over 35 mph carrying rocks, mud and vegetation.

The volcano is located along the “Pacific Ring of Fire” that also experiences nearly daily earthquakes.
